Understanding the commercial and industrial landscape driving PP cup demand across Great Britain.
The United Kingdom is one of Europe's most dynamic markets for disposable and reusable cup solutions. With over 70,000 coffee shops operating across the country and a booming bubble tea and cold beverage culture — particularly in London, Manchester, Birmingham, and Edinburgh — the demand for high-quality polypropylene (PP) cups has never been stronger.
British consumers and foodservice operators increasingly seek cups that combine functionality, branding potential, and environmental responsibility. Polypropylene cups answer this demand by offering superior clarity, heat resistance, chemical inertness, and full custom-print capabilities — making them the material of choice for both hot and cold beverage applications.
From high-street chains like Caffè Nero and Costa Coffee to independent artisan cafés in Shoreditch or Edinburgh's Grassmarket, and from NHS hospital canteens to Premier League stadium concessions, custom PP cups have become an indispensable part of the UK's commercial foodservice infrastructure.
The UK foodservice packaging market is valued at over £4.2 billion annually, with cups and drinking vessels representing one of the fastest-growing sub-segments. PP cups account for a significant and growing share as operators transition away from single-use polystyrene.
UK supermarket chains including Tesco, Sainsbury's, Waitrose, and ASDA have increased private-label cup product ranges, sourcing custom PP cups for in-store deli, café, and ready-meal applications, driving volume purchasing from verified international manufacturers.
Beyond foodservice, PP cups are widely used across the UK's construction, healthcare, and events industries — from site welfare facilities on major infrastructure projects like HS2 to large-scale events such as Glastonbury Festival and Wimbledon Championships.
The British packaging landscape is evolving rapidly. Here are the critical trends every UK buyer should understand.
Following the England & Wales ban on single-use plastic cutlery and plates in 2023, the UK market is pivoting towards recyclable PP formats. Polypropylene, being widely accepted by UK kerbside recycling programmes, has emerged as the compliant, preferred polymer for disposable cup production.
With the UK government's Extended Producer Responsibility (EPR) scheme now in effect and ongoing discussion around a formal "latte levy" on non-recyclable cups, operators are proactively switching to fully recyclable PP and PLA alternatives to avoid future cost liabilities and align with ESG commitments.
UK brand owners are leveraging cups as a powerful marketing touchpoint. Digital and flexographic printing technologies now allow full-colour, photographic-quality branding on PP cups — even for short runs — driving rapid growth in custom-printed orders from SME café operators and national QSR chains alike.
The UK bubble tea market has grown by over 42% since 2020, with specialist chains proliferating across London, Manchester, Leeds, and Glasgow. This sector's preference for clear, wide-diameter PP cups with secure sealing lids has created a booming specialist sub-category for custom cup manufacturers.
Forward-thinking manufacturers are deploying AI-assisted packaging design systems capable of 24-hour rapid prototyping, reducing material waste by up to 20% and accelerating new product launches. UK buyers benefit from faster turnaround, tighter tolerances, and smarter supply chains.
Post-Brexit supply chain disruptions have prompted UK foodservice operators to diversify their supplier base. While domestic PP cup production capacity remains limited, working with ISO-certified Asian manufacturers with UK-compliant products, reliable logistics, and digital inventory systems has become standard practice.
